DescriptionA potent and effective calcium-sensitive opener of maxi-K potassium channels (maxi-K) with EC50 of 392 nM at -48.4 mV in HEK293 isolated outside-out membrane patches; a potent and effective opener of two important subtypes of neuronal potassium channels, K(Ca) channels and KCNQ channels, strongly activates the voltage-gated K+ channel KCNQ5 with EC50 of 2.4 uM; shows significant levels of cortical neuroprotection in rat models of permanent large-vessel stroke.Stroke Phase 3 Discontinued
